Factors Affecting Cost
- Severity of the Leak: Minor leaks may only require simple fixes, while severe leaks can necessitate extensive repairs.
- Type of Repair Needed: Different repair methods, such as sealing cracks or installing drainage systems, come with varying costs.
- Foundation Type: The material and construction of the basement foundation can influence the complexity and cost of repairs.
- Access to the Basement: Easier access can reduce labor costs, while difficult access can increase them.
- Waterproofing Method: Interior vs. exterior waterproofing methods have different cost implications.
- Extent of Water Damage: Additional repairs for water-damaged walls, floors, or personal property can add to the overall cost.
- Local Labor Rates: Labor costs in Michigan City, IN, can vary based on the contractor and market conditions.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Crack Sealing | $300 - $800 |
Interior Waterproofing |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Exterior Waterproofing | $3,000 - $10,000 |
Sump Pump Installation | $700 - $1,500 |
French Drain Installation | $5,000 - $15,000 |
Mold Remediation | $500 - $6,000 |
Foundation Repair | $2,000 - $7,000 |
Basement Wall Reinforcement | $4,000 - $12,000 |
